This weekend, I had a couple of seemingly insignificant experiences that actually really made me think. . . On Friday, I was driving to work (at the speed limit) when it appeared that everyone and their mother was passing me and speeding down the highway. For a minute, I was really bothered and considered picking up my speed but I changed my mind. It's funny. I thought about parents who tell their children, "Just because ' everybody else' may be doing something, that doesn't make it right." That is the absolute truth! As a young person- especially as a young Christian, it can be discouraging to feel like other people are passing you or leaving you in the dust. It may seem like they're progressing faster than you. (Things aren't always what they seem.) Be encouraged! In my case, plenty of people were driving faster than me and maybe they reached their destinations before me but that doesn't mean that they went about things the right way...
